The Deep
19 minutes' walk
An interactive aquarium featuring marine life from around the world, with stunning exhibits and a glass tunnel.
Hull Maritime Museum
15 minutes' walk
Showcases Hull's rich maritime history with fascinating exhibits, including whaling memorabilia and marine art.
Ferens Art Gallery
15 minutes' walk
A renowned gallery featuring British and European artworks, along with temporary exhibitions and family-friendly activities.
Streetlife Museum of Transport
19 minutes' walk
Offers a glimpse into the past with vintage vehicles and interactive displays on the history of transport in Hull.
